Good luck.

Click here for more information on software engineering. I know that Canadian students don’t have to take the SATs, but do you happen to know a what a safe score would be to be in the safe acceptance zone for any of the programs above? What part of software development or computers are you most interested in and what level of programming experience do you have? which field is better at this time computer science engineering or software engineering? I find that anything to do with computer programming and security will be incredibly useful for now and in the future. Having a degree in civil engineering doesn’t imply one will never do computer/software engineering and vice versa.

I’ve done some scientific and empirical studies on this. In our admission process, we challenge your ambition and talent. They’re a living dictionary. There will be opportunities for you to take electives in upper years where you will be able to narrow down your interests. Software Engineering. If you take design patterns for example. Based on the curriculum for Software Engineering and based on how busy engineering students tend to be in general, I think it would be harder to do this with Software Engineering than with Computer Science. It’s even developed a bit of a rock star image. At my school Computing Science was 90% practical work, and only 10% theory, so it would really be considered Software Engineering. The best thing to consider when choosing between programs is the courses that you will be taking in the program. Do you relish getting called in as “tech support” for friends or family members? Architects in every country keep this person on their speed-dial for every design and construction project. From what I’m aware of, it is typically not possible to switch between CE and SE once you have started your program but it is possible to switch into CS. How easy is it to change from CE to either CS or SE if I ever decide to do this in the future ? As for the course load, I can say by experience that having 6+ courses in Engineering is a lot of work. Due to a strong dual education system (combining an apprenticeship in a company with vocational training at a vocational school) the role of German universities was traditionally focussed on scientific education while looking down on the idea of teaching hands-on knowledge and skills with practical relevance with regard to future employers. Nos partenaires et nous-mêmes stockerons et/ou utiliserons des informations concernant votre appareil, par l’intermédiaire de cookies et de technologies similaires, afin d’afficher des annonces et des contenus personnalisés, de mesurer les audiences et les contenus, d’obtenir des informations sur les audiences et à des fins de développement de produit. A huge number of SE courses *are* CS. That is the article is based on a post-modernistic view of science. At least it seems that way, haha. You can really specialize in these areas in upper-year courses and through co-op terms.

Change ), You are commenting using your Google account. Go ahead and apply now. It’s the only course that even comes close to the difficulty of a Computer Science degree. I teach computer science majors at a U.S. community college, and the non-passing rates are even higher in this context. Finally, your choice between computer science and computer engineering as undergraduate majors may be less important than your overall choice of college.

Please guide me.. She also enjoys fiber art, murder mysteries, and amateur entomology. Especially starting out with minimalism, just learning the minimum you need to learn and do the minimum your need to do to achieve a given objective then building up from that. Computer Science is software and its mathematical foundations. Celina

If one of these approaches to technology is particularly appealing to you, gives you opportunities to use your talents in a satisfying way, and allows you to achieve your personal goals for your adult life, it’s likely the better choice for you as an individual. I am not familiar with what is available but there are definitely plenty of different electives to choose from. In it you will learn everything about software and all that revolves around it. A few times in my introductory programming course, I will mention this fact (that computer science is among the hardest majors), partly to set expectations that students will need to work hard to succeed.

Can Applying Under a Certain Major Affect Your Chances of Admission?

( Log Out /  Instead, it really depends on what your interest is in for greater chances of success. Computer Science has a strong origin as a predominantly mathematical discipline but has expanded to incorporate anything to do with computing.

By comparison the SE approach was very by the book. In contrast to the other two programs, Computer Engineering is focused more on the designing and developing of computer systems and how the software interacts with the hardware. Emphasise on language. That said, the content itself in computer science isn't necessarily easy. I’m in Electrical Engineering and I currently have five heavily academic courses, one course on engineering practices that isn’t very demanding, a course on co-op, and a course on academic success. While you’ll still need to build a strong math background, if you study computer engineering, you’ll spend more time working with actual computer hardware and focusing on practical, hands-on skills for working with technology and solving real-world technical problems. You won’t always have a choice between computer science and computer engineering at a given college; many colleges only offer one or the other. Successful architecture includes creativity, vision, multi-disciplinary thinking, and humanity.

The Top 10 Most Underrated Engineering Colleges in the U.S. Wake Forest Acceptance Rate: What Does It Take to Get In? You’re more likely to find computer science as an option at a wide range of top-tier colleges than computer engineering. https://uwaterloo.ca/find-out-more/admissions/admission-requirements. I took both CS courses and EE courses and my impressions is that EE has harder material, but the classes weren't necessarily harder. We spoke to the construction team, Aber storms: A tree fell on an English lecturer’s car outside the Hugh Owen building, Yesterday’s storm in Aber was pretty bad, but experts say it definitely wasn’t a tornado, The 13 straight-up dumbest moments in Netflix movie The Princess Switch 2, Quiz: If you can name these posh foods you should go on MasterChef: The Professionals.

Electronic and computer engineering.

I am going to apply to U Waterloo from an American High School soon. The missing gap here is learning programming. To reiterate, Computer Engineering is based on the hardware and software, Computer Science is based more on the algorithms and theory behind programming, and Software Engineering is a mix of both, teaching the applications of programming while still having a basic science background.

Create a free website or blog at WordPress.com. This is a place for engineering students of any discipline to discuss study methods, get homework help, get job search advice, and find a compassionate ear when you get a 40% on your midterm after studying all night. Check with your college for more information. Through the 1970s, getting a job in computers required a degree in mathematics, and you happened to take some computing courses on the side because there was no discipline yet in existence expressly for computer science.

I have encountered this too when I was choosing my program because computer engineering, software engineering, and computer science all looked like great options for me. It depends on the University/curriculum as well in certain countries. One last thing to note is the access to coop.

Quite often you can choose which direction you want to go by choosing modules.

Both majors are heavy in theory and practical application, which is vital for building a strong knowledge base for a range of IT careers, however, the key difference is that computer science focuses on software, while computer engineering is more about the hardware.

Does this make it a heavier work load or is the work load similar to 5 courses per semester(eg. The difference now is that software engineers tend to get a bit more electrical an computer engineering coursework and sometimes a dash learning business processes regarding software development (e.g. Is it possible to have an Cardiologist without strong foundations in Medicine? and after i finish my preparatory class(which is after 1 year) Further more not a single hole can be found in their knowledge of different writing styles. Découvrez comment nous utilisons vos informations dans notre Politique relative à la vie privée et notre Politique relative aux cookies. Before I answer anything, I would like to make it clear now that Computer Science is no longer available as an alternative program when you apply to Software Engineering.